SENT TO TURIN – Massimiliano Allegri at the press conference said he was satisfied with the performance of his team, the rankings improved, but turned your thoughts primarily to the match on Wednesday in Champions League against Manchester City.
Allegri, as commented this victory against Milan?
It was not a good match and in the first half we struggled to find spaces also allargavamo because the maneuver on the right wing. Milan could hurt us on the counterattack, but we were careful. In the second half we played better, spaces widened, our pace has remained important and Dybala has done a great goal. It was important to overcome AC Milan and a third win in a row. Although we are far from the summit we are happy because we beat a direct competitor.
Dybala yet been decisive and the controversy over its use are fading.
Dybala is growing and tonight it did well. In the future will also better because it improved from a physical and tactical.
Why did you choose Mandzukic from 1 ‘? Why
Morata and Cuadrado could be important changes after the break, but I burned two substitutions because of injuries to Evra and Hernanes.
How are the injured?
Khedira has had a recurrence of the old scar thigh injury. It was not well and we realized that there was no need to risk. In a week it will be recovered. The injury Hernanes groin if it is procured from the free kick, but Wednesday will be disqualified.
